Mirrored Heavens by Rebecca Roanhorse (Book 3 of Between Earth and Sky)

By John Folk-Williams

Mirrored Heavens

One of the great themes of Rebecca Roanhorse’s impressive third volume of her Between Earth and Sky trilogy is the struggle of humans to use godlike power without being destroyed by it. In Mirrored Heavens, the major characters either reach for such power or have it imposed on them, and all pay a heavy price. […]

David Mogo Godhunter by Suyi Davies Okungbowa

By John Folk-Williams

David Mogo Godhunter

In David Mogo Godhunter by Suyi Davies Okungbowa (author of Son of the Storm) the end of the world has come to Lagos. After a war among orishas, or gods, in Orun, home of a major pantheon, hundreds of spirits have taken over most of the city in the great Falling. Much of it lies […]
